Ingredients
- 6 pounds beef brisket
- 1 tablespoon yellow mustard
- 1/4 cup dark brown sugar
- 3/4 cup paprika
- 2 tablespoons chipotle chili powder
- 1/4 cup black pepper
- 2 tablespoons garlic powder
- 1/4 cup salt
- 2 tablespoons onion powder
- 1 tablespoon cayenne pepper
Instructions
- Trim the fat cap on the brisket to about 1/4 to 1/8 of an inch. Coat the brisket with a light coating of the yellow mustard. Mix the sugar and spices together to form the rub for the brisket. Apply the rub to both sides of the meat.
- Place the brisket in a preheated 194 to 205 degree F smoker until the meat reaches an internal temperature of 185 to 195 degrees F, about 1 1/2 hours per pound. Once the internal temperature is reached, remove the brisket from the smoker and allow it to rest for at least 30 minutes before slicing.
